Why does CertiFACTS Online show medical board certification with expired dates?
If the board certification verification is within the past year, the physician may have recertified, but, for whatever reason, this board certification information has not yet been forwarded to ABMS. You will need to contact the board directly to inquire about that particular physician. We have chosen to keep diplomates with expired medical certificates in the database so you can access the status and decide if you wish to investigate further. Medical board certification that we know is expired will show up in red text on the results screen. If we have no ending date on a time-limited medical certificate, the result will not show up in red; however, please refer to the time-limited tables for further information, or contact the member board directly.
